Ludwig Keck - 2023 Brown-headed Nuthatch

Brown-headed nuthatch with peeled sunflower seed. EXIF says distance was 2.24 meters, and depth of field 16 mm. Aperture at f/5.6, shutter speed 1/200 sec, ISO 2200, lens zoom at 300 mm. Nikon D800 with AF-S VR Zoom-Nikkor 70-300mm f/4.5-5.6G IF-ED. They say to always focus on the eyes – I tried.

Morning Glory

Yes, yes, I know this is not what is called a Morning Glory, but this is a morning glory – a pumpkin blossom. These flowers last just a few hours in the morning. By the time the noontime sun reaches them they will have closed up.
